Great US and World Libraries
To celebrate National Library Week, The Huffington Post is letting users review images of libraries and then vote on their favorite buldings/reading rooms in the United States. National Library Week 2010: America's Most Amazing Libraries Images of nine libraries are included it the article.
The nine libraries are:
The New York Public Library
Exeter Academy Library
George People Library
The Boston Public Library
Salt Lake City Public Library
Seattle Public Library
Yale University Beinecke Rare Book and Manuscript Library
Library of Congress

In January, The Huffington Post also ran images of libraries from around world(including the U.S.) along with a poll allowing readers to rank, “The Most Amazing Libraries in the World.” It still looks like you can vote.
The top five libraries with the most votes are:
1) Trinity College Library (”The Long Room”)
2) Abbey Library of St. Gal
3) The Library of Congress (Same Image as Above)
4) Stockholm Public Library
5) Reading Room at the British Museum
